Pages : 1
#1 Le 09/05/2009, à 13:25
- beronono
UUID d'un disque introuvable... [RéSOLU]
Bonjour,
J'ai besoin de l'UUID de mon disque sda1, il ne sort pas avec la commande suivante... La partition n'est pas cachée, elle est boot
laurent@laurent-desktop:~$ sudo ls -l /dev/disk/by-uuid/
total 0
lrwxrwxrwx 1 root root 10 2009-05-09 17:03 0996b96e-3d86-4395-9cf5-cb744b543a52 -> ../../sdb2
lrwxrwxrwx 1 root root 10 2009-05-09 17:03 3525ee82-8d13-4caa-a27e-14de985f432d -> ../../sdd1
lrwxrwxrwx 1 root root 10 2009-05-09 17:03 3CE6F2CCE6F28584 -> ../../sdc1
lrwxrwxrwx 1 root root 10 2009-05-09 17:03 4719251d-7125-4cab-9c27-a374f6e8cc94 -> ../../sda3
lrwxrwxrwx 1 root root 10 2009-05-09 17:03 874f1964-28ec-4545-af20-fafd607f71be -> ../../sda5
lrwxrwxrwx 1 root root 10 2009-05-09 14:04 ae3d478a-1a6c-4d37-8992-a4e039181076 -> ../../sdb1
lrwxrwxrwx 1 root root 10 2009-05-09 15:15 D424A4F024A4D6B0 -> ../../sda2
lrwxrwxrwx 1 root root 10 2009-05-09 17:03 f18fcb38-9eaa-41bf-a0a4-2ac890297e4b -> ../../sda6
laurent@laurent-desktop:~$ sudo fdisk -l
Disque /dev/sda: 750.1 Go, 750156374016 octets
255 têtes, 63 secteurs/piste, 91201 cylindres
Unités = cylindres de 16065 * 512 = 8225280 octets
Identifiant de disque : 0x744bc8e4
Périphérique Amorce Début Fin Blocs Id Système
/dev/sda1 * 1 16939 136062486 83 Linux
/dev/sda2 16940 29687 102398310 7 HPFS/NTFS
/dev/sda3 29688 41844 97651102+ 83 Linux
/dev/sda4 41845 91201 396460102+ 5 Etendue
/dev/sda5 41845 89034 379053643+ 83 Linux
/dev/sda6 89035 91201 17406396 82 Linux swap / Solaris
Disque /dev/sdb: 750.1 Go, 750156374016 octets
255 têtes, 63 secteurs/piste, 91201 cylindres
Unités = cylindres de 16065 * 512 = 8225280 octets
Identifiant de disque : 0x000be274
Périphérique Amorce Début Fin Blocs Id Système
/dev/sdb1 1 45600 366281968+ 83 Linux
/dev/sdb2 45601 91201 366290032+ 83 Linux
Disque /dev/sdc: 400.0 Go, 400088457216 octets
255 têtes, 63 secteurs/piste, 48641 cylindres
Unités = cylindres de 16065 * 512 = 8225280 octets
Identifiant de disque : 0xd7507acf
Périphérique Amorce Début Fin Blocs Id Système
/dev/sdc1 1 48642 390709248 7 HPFS/NTFS
Disque /dev/sdd: 400.0 Go, 400088457216 octets
255 têtes, 63 secteurs/piste, 48641 cylindres
Unités = cylindres de 16065 * 512 = 8225280 octets
Identifiant de disque : 0x88278827
Périphérique Amorce Début Fin Blocs Id Système
/dev/sdd1 * 1 48641 390708801 83 Linux
Quelqu'un sait comment faire ?
Merci d'avance
Dernière modification par beronono (Le 09/05/2009, à 14:17)
Linux toshi 2.6.31-11-generic #36-Ubuntu SMP Fri Sep 25 06:37:23 UTC 2009 x86_64 GNU/Linux
Hors ligne
#2 Le 09/05/2009, à 13:31
- denis_aec
Re : UUID d'un disque introuvable... [RéSOLU]
essaie ça :
sudo blkid
Hors ligne
#3 Le 09/05/2009, à 13:32
- bertrand0
Re : UUID d'un disque introuvable... [RéSOLU]
sudo vol_id /dev/sda1
Au passage, je vous rapelle que l'uuid du volume est stocké par le système de fichier présent sur le volume. Autrement dit un volume non formatté n'a pas d'uuid... (en tout cas sur des disques à table de partitions mdos, je ne parle pas du gpt ou autres...)
Dernière modification par bertrand0 (Le 09/05/2009, à 13:36)
Ceux qui écrivent comme ils parlent, quoiqu'ils parlent très bien, écrivent mal.
Buffon, Discours sur le style
Hors ligne
#4 Le 09/05/2009, à 13:38
- beronono
Re : UUID d'un disque introuvable... [RéSOLU]
laurent@laurent-desktop:~$ sudo blkid
/dev/sda1: UUID="ae3d478a-1a6c-4d37-8992-a4e039181076" TYPE="ext3"
/dev/sda2: UUID="D424A4F024A4D6B0" TYPE="ntfs"
/dev/sda5: UUID="874f1964-28ec-4545-af20-fafd607f71be" SEC_TYPE="ext2" TYPE="ext3"
/dev/sda6: TYPE="swap" UUID="f18fcb38-9eaa-41bf-a0a4-2ac890297e4b"
/dev/sdc1: UUID="3CE6F2CCE6F28584" LABEL="Nouveau nom" TYPE="ntfs"
/dev/sdd1: UUID="3525ee82-8d13-4caa-a27e-14de985f432d" SEC_TYPE="ext2" TYPE="ext3" LABEL="Divers"
/dev/sdb1: UUID="ae3d478a-1a6c-4d37-8992-a4e039181076" SEC_TYPE="ext2" TYPE="ext3"
/dev/sdb2: UUID="0996b96e-3d86-4395-9cf5-cb744b543a52" SEC_TYPE="ext2" TYPE="ext3"
/dev/sda3: UUID="4719251d-7125-4cab-9c27-a374f6e8cc94" TYPE="ext3"
/dev/ramzswap0: TYPE="swap"
laurent@laurent-desktop:~$ sudo vol_id /dev/sda1
ID_FS_USAGE=filesystem
ID_FS_TYPE=ext3
ID_FS_VERSION=1.0
ID_FS_UUID=ae3d478a-1a6c-4d37-8992-a4e039181076
ID_FS_UUID_ENC=ae3d478a-1a6c-4d37-8992-a4e039181076
ID_FS_LABEL=
ID_FS_LABEL_ENC=
Merci, ça marche,
Mais HELP !!! J'ai deux partitions avec la même UUID !!! sda1 et sdb1...
Comment rectifier cette erreur (et horreur !) ?
Linux toshi 2.6.31-11-generic #36-Ubuntu SMP Fri Sep 25 06:37:23 UTC 2009 x86_64 GNU/Linux
Hors ligne
#5 Le 09/05/2009, à 13:39
- beronono
Re : UUID d'un disque introuvable... [RéSOLU]
Mes posts sont en double depuis ce matin, je ne comprend pas, désolé !
Linux toshi 2.6.31-11-generic #36-Ubuntu SMP Fri Sep 25 06:37:23 UTC 2009 x86_64 GNU/Linux
Hors ligne
#6 Le 09/05/2009, à 13:45
- bertrand0
Re : UUID d'un disque introuvable... [RéSOLU]
sudo tune2fs -U random /dev/sda1
(il est préférable sans être indispensable de taper cette commande quand la partition est démontée.)
Ceux qui écrivent comme ils parlent, quoiqu'ils parlent très bien, écrivent mal.
Buffon, Discours sur le style
Hors ligne
#7 Le 09/05/2009, à 13:50
- beronono
Re : UUID d'un disque introuvable... [RéSOLU]
Merci infiniment bertrand0 !
Au moment ou j'ai vu ta réponse j'étais en train de lire que c'était faisable avec la commande uuidgen ?
A votre avis tune2fs ou uuidgen ?
Encore merci du temps consacré à mes ignorances...
Linux toshi 2.6.31-11-generic #36-Ubuntu SMP Fri Sep 25 06:37:23 UTC 2009 x86_64 GNU/Linux
Hors ligne
#8 Le 09/05/2009, à 13:56
- bertrand0
Re : UUID d'un disque introuvable... [RéSOLU]
uuidgen ne fait que créer une valeur uuid, qu'il faut ensuite insérer par d'autres moyens à l'endroit désiré. tune2fs est un outil dédié spécifiquement au système de fichiers ext2/3/4 qui génère un uuid puis l'insère dans les infos du système de fichiers. En fait, sans en être sûr à 100%, je croie que ces deux programmes font appel à la même bibliothèque libuuid pour créer la valeur uuid, ce qui signifie que du point de vue de la séquence générée, c'est bonnet blanc et blanc bonnet.
Dernière modification par bertrand0 (Le 09/05/2009, à 13:58)
Ceux qui écrivent comme ils parlent, quoiqu'ils parlent très bien, écrivent mal.
Buffon, Discours sur le style
Hors ligne
#9 Le 09/05/2009, à 14:02
- beronono
Re : UUID d'un disque introuvable... [RéSOLU]
Parfaitement clair.
Je reviens dans quelques minutes pour marquer [résolu], le temps de faire la manip avec un LiveCD.
sda1 est mon root et sdb1 mon home, je n'ai pas du tout envie de faire ça sur les partitions montées...
Encore merci !
Linux toshi 2.6.31-11-generic #36-Ubuntu SMP Fri Sep 25 06:37:23 UTC 2009 x86_64 GNU/Linux
Hors ligne
#10 Le 09/05/2009, à 14:16
- denis_aec
Re : UUID d'un disque introuvable... [RéSOLU]
Pour obtenir le même uuid, tu as du faire une sauvegarde / restauration sur une autre partition ... via dd, partimage, ...
et le fait d'avoir 2 part avec le même uuid explique pourquoi le "ls -l /dev/disk/by-uuid/" n'en renvoie qu'une.
Hors ligne
#11 Le 09/05/2009, à 14:16
- beronono
Re : UUID d'un disque introuvable... [RéSOLU]
Génial, et du coup ça règle aussi mon problème de grub2 !
Linux toshi 2.6.31-11-generic #36-Ubuntu SMP Fri Sep 25 06:37:23 UTC 2009 x86_64 GNU/Linux
Hors ligne
#12 Le 24/04/2010, à 10:53
- 3rwan
Re : UUID d'un disque introuvable... [RéSOLU]
salut,
qu'en est-il d'un uuid pour une partition hfs+?
j'ai beau avoir reformaté la partition plusieurs fois avec gparted, la commande blkid /dev/sda4 me renvoie:
/dev/sda4: LABEL="macosx" TYPE="hfsplus"
uuidgen me donne un uuid, mais j'ai beau cherché je ne trouve pas comment l'inserer dans la partition.
si quelqu'un a une idée?
Hors ligne
Pages : 1